SENIOR SUPPLIER DEVELOPMENT ENGINEER I/II - MECHANICAL

Based out of Rocket Lab's headquarters in Long Beach, CA the Senior Supplier Development Engineer I/II - Mechanical is the primary technical owner of the supply base for a broad portfolio of mechanical hardware. This role is responsible for leading the end-to-end industrialization of suppliers from source selection and process qualification through NPI, PPAP, and production ramp thereby ensuring that every supplier can deliver conforming hardware at rate, on cost, and on schedule.

This is a hands-on, supplier-facing role requiring deep commodity knowledge across mechanical domains including but not limited to Complex Machined Parts, Electro-Mechanical Assemblies, Structural Composites, 3D printing and raw materials. The SDE operates proactively at the intersection of design, manufacturing, procurement, and quality. They are the ultimate internal advocate for supply chain manufacturability and capability.

WHAT YOU'LL GET TO DO:
  • Lead end-to-end supplier industrialization for mechanical hardware from source selection and process qualification through NPI, PPAP, and rate production ramp.
  • Partner with procurement and engineering to identify, evaluate, and select suppliers based on process capability, quality systems, and capacity across CNC machining, EDM, grinding, additive manufacturing, welding and electro-mechanical assemblies.
  • Conduct supplier capability assessments during qualification phases, evaluating tooling maturity, measurement systems, process controls, and workforce qualification against program requirements.
  • Lead Design for Manufacturability (DFM) reviews with design engineering at the earliest program stage, providing actionable feedback on feature complexity, datum schemes, tolerance stack-ups, and design characteristics that drive cost or quality risk.
  • Own the APQP process at suppliers, driving completion of all quality planning deliverables - process flow, PFMEA, control plan, MSA/GR&R, and dimensional results - on schedule and to the required standard.
  • Drive the PPAP program as a production readiness gate; define required submission levels, disposition supplier packages, and ensure process capability (Cpk) is demonstrated on critical and significant characteristics to enable at rate production.
  • Lead First Article Inspection (FAI) activities at suppliers and in coordination with internal quality teams; ensure all findings are resolved to closure within project timelines.
  • Identify systemic performance gaps; own supplier improvement plans and drive measurable progress against quality, cost, delivery, and capacity targets.
  • Lead root cause and corrective action (RCCA) for supplier quality issues and escapes, applying structured problem-solving methods (8D, 5-Why) and validating that corrective actions are robust and sustained across all applicable parts and production lines.
  • Apply lean manufacturing and statistical quality tools - including SPC, Cpk trending, and process audits - to drive continuous improvement across the mechanical supply base and eliminate sources of recurring defect.

About Rocket Lab

Rocket Lab is a private American aerospace manufacturer and small satellite launch service provider. The company was founded in 2006 by New Zealander Peter Beck. Rocket Lab's Electron rocket is designed to launch small payloads of up to 300 kg into low Earth orbit. The company has launched several successful missions and has contracts with NASA and other organizations. Rocket Lab has raised over $200 million in funding and has offices in the United States and New Zealand.
